NeighbourhoodThis detached house on Citroenvlinder 2 sits in the Luchen neighbourhood, a leafy part of Mierlo. Built in 2013, it offers 223 m² of living space on a 625 m² plot, with an A energy label. The asking price of €1,175,000 is on the high side compared to other detached houses in Geldrop-Mierlo, but the modern build and generous proportions justify it.
Luchen is a quiet, green neighbourhood where most homes are owner-occupied (81%) and predominantly single-family houses (94%). With 1,630 residents and an average household size of 2.8, it's a place where families and couples feel at home. The area scores low on urbanity (4 out of 5), so you get plenty of peace and space. There are no resident reviews available for this neighbourhood, but the figures speak for themselves: a low crime rate (19 incidents total) and a strong sense of community. For your daily shopping, Aldi is just around the corner, and Albert Heijn and Lidl are a ten-minute walk away. Basisschool De Kersentuin is a couple of streets away, while Mondomijn and Openbare Basisschool 't Schrijverke are within a ten-minute walk. The neighbourhood also has a park or public garden a ten-minute walk away, perfect for a stroll. The home has an energy label A, which means it is very energy-efficient. You can expect low heating and electricity costs compared to older homes. The modern construction (2013) and good insulation contribute to this rating.
The nearest train station is 3.65 km away, which is about a 10-minute drive or a 45-minute walk. It's not within walking distance for a daily commute, but cycling or driving is convenient.
There are several primary schools within walking distance: Basisschool De Kersentuin (976 m), Mondomijn (1.6 km), and Openbare Basisschool 't Schrijverke (1.7 km). For secondary education, the nearest school is 3.96 km away, so a bike or car ride is needed.
Luchen has a low crime rate, with only 19 total incidents recorded. It's a quiet, family-oriented neighbourhood where most residents own their homes, contributing to a safe and stable environment.
Aldi is just 828 m away, so you can walk there in about 10 minutes. Albert Heijn and Lidl are both 1.5 km away, a 15-20 minute walk. For a wider selection, there are 24 supermarkets within 5 km.
The plot is 625 m², which is generous for a detached home. The listing does not specify a garden, but the plot size suggests there is outdoor space.
